- Assess Strategy, Brand Fit
In evaluating PR agencies Singapore, the initial criterion is to gauge how well they can study your brand at a deeper level.
A powerful agency does not immediately dive into action. Rather, it starts with an analysis of your brand image, target market, and long-term goals. This strategic basis means that all campaigns will be in line with your business objectives. In its absence, even properly implemented campaigns can fail to have any meaningful effect.
Also, strategically driven agencies are more likely to be able to predict challenges and respond to market changes. With their ideas, your brand will be well-positioned, and your message will remain consistent across all media.
It is a good idea to select an agency that is strategic in its thinking so that your PR activities are focused and yield outcomes.

- Analyze Media Influencer Connections
Media relationships are an important part of PR success. A well-established agency will be able to offer superior coverage and more purposeful placements to your brand.
Such ties extend past contact lists. These include the knowledge of what various media outlets seek and how to pitch it. This has a higher chance of your story being picked up and published.
Secondly, influencer partnerships have become a necessary component of contemporary PR. Media and influencer management agencies can increase your presence on various platforms.
Assessment of these networks will help your brand receive exposure to credible and reliable channels.
